The Enterprise Development Authority’s CEO, Nevin Jameh, announced that the current session of the “Our Heritage 2022” exhibition, which is being sponsored by President Abdel Fattah El-Sisi, the President of the Republic, will see the allocation of an entire pavilion for the Authority’s services, enabling exhibition attendees to learn about all of the Authority’s financial and non-financial services and apply for these services.

The services, in addition to raising awareness of the benefits and facilities provided by the Enterprise Development Law for current and new small projects, which is an opportunity to gain from these various services, and indicated that the pavilion will also include a group of specialised experts from the agency to provide a significant number of marketing and technical services for all heritage projects, whether from participating exhibitors or One of the owners of her business

These services, according to Jameh, are offered without charge and include designing the project’s brand “logo,” building websites, designing social media marketing pages, and possibly marketing the project’s products on significant commercial platforms from partners like Amazon Egypt and Jumia. They also include consulting focused on tailoring each product to consumers’ needs and modern design trends.

She emphasised that the agency is constantly working to develop these services to keep up with the market’s rapid changes in selling and buying mechanisms in order to assist project owners in utilising the promising online marketing opportunities and enhancing the quality of their products in order to compete locally and internationally.

Nevin Jameh extends an invitation to owners of handicraft and heritage projects to attend the exhibition in order to learn more about and take advantage of the services offered by the device. Nevin Jameh also emphasised the significance of young people generally being aware of these services in order to establish new small projects or expand their current projects during the exhibition period.

The fourth session of the “Our Heritage” exhibition will run from October 9 through October 15, every day from 11 am to 10 pm at the Egypt International Exhibition Center on the Moshir axis of the Fifth Settlement, with the exception of October 9 Sunday. The public can view the display starting at 4 o’clock.
